Explain the three major ways the body handles potentiallydeveloping acidosis (which can be life-threatening, if not dealtwith).

There are 2 types of acids Volatile formed by metabolism of carbohydrates proteins and fats Its is excreted as Co2 from lungs Non volatile acids Fixed acids Formed by metabolism of Phospholipid and nucleic acids Eg Sulphurica acids phosphoric acids and organic acids Excreted by kidneys According To Henderson Hasselbachs equation Important determinants of H acids are 1 Bicarbonate 2226 meql 2 Pco2 40 mm hg Equation is PH pka Log Hco3 H2Co3 Acidosis may be of metabolic cause if bicarbonate is less in body or Respiratory if excess of Co2 in body Normally body main function is to get rid of excess of acids and help in homeostais First defence Chemical buffer system Second defence Respiratory buffer system Third defence Renal
